Made-with: Cursor * temporarily disable fail-fast on agnostic tests to debug checkout@v6 Made-with: Cursor * re-enable fail-fast on agnostic tests Made-with: Cursor * fix test token mismatch: mint OIDC tokens scoped to target repo CI tests override GITHUB_REPOSITORY to pullfrog/test-repo but inherit the runner's GITHUB_TOKEN (scoped to pullfrog/app), causing 401s on every run-context fetch. Clear GITHUB_TOKEN in the test subprocess so ensureGitHubToken() mints a properly scoped token via OIDC. Also centralizes the default GITHUB_REPOSITORY in runAgentStreaming instead of repeating it in every test file, and fixes preview-cleanup to remove workers from all queues (not just name-matching ones). Made-with: Cursor * fix ensureGitHubToken to try OIDC when app credentials are absent ensureGitHubToken only attempted token minting when GITHUB_APP_ID and GITHUB_PRIVATE_KEY were set. In CI, OIDC is available but app creds aren't exposed — so the guard prevented minting entirely.
